November 24th: Celebrate Christmas in Downtown Rochester with Lagniappe and the Big, Bright Light Show

On Monday, Nov. 24th, downtown Rochester Christmas comes to life with everyone’s favorite day of the season, Lagniappe! Named with the Creole word for “a little something extra,” Lagniappe is a way for the business owners in Rochester to express their gratitude to supportive members of the community.

From 6:00 to 9:00 PM, anyone can stop by Novel and our neighboring businesses to shop, grab a sandwich, and gather with loved ones! Main Street itself will be closed, so make sure to arrive early to secure parking.  

That same night, the Big, Bright Light Show will illuminate the storefronts of downtown Rochester! Sponsored by Fox Automotive, the Mayor, Channel 7, and Santa Claus himself, the festivities will kick off at 6:00 PM. At 7:00 PM, the lights go up and fireworks go off! The display will shine bright from 5:00 PM to midnight every night until Jan. 18th to make downtown Rochester’s holiday magic last.

December 5th and 6th: Lean Into Festive Fun with the Kris Kringle Market

Inspired by traditional European open-air Christmas markets, the Kris Kringle market is a family-favorite downtown Rochester holiday event year after year. Open 4:00 to 10:00 PM Friday and 12:00 to 10:00 PM Saturday, the market holds more than 60 vendors, a warming tent with beer, wine, and musical entertainment, and more fun for all ages!
